29/04/2022 (Agence Europe) – The pace of negotiations is too slow and too little progress has been made recently on the agriculture package at the World Trade Organization (WTO), according to Gloria Abraham Peralta (Costa Rica), who is chairing the discussions on the subject. At the 12th Ministerial Conference (MC12), from 12 to 15 June, an agreement is expected or hoped for on this issue, but this prospect is becoming more remote. Members agreed to include elements on food security in the final text, due to the current context. However, they are divided on permanent public food storage measures. On this and other issues, a compromise is not yet within reach, according to a Geneva source. (LM)
